Get Outdoors Around the World Challenge — Family FUN
Brum Woods 611 South Mulberry Street, Batesville, IN, United StatesGet Outdoors Around the World Challenge! THIS MONTH OUR COUNTRY IS JAPAN! Let's play games!!! Some Japanese children’s playground games are, the Manner Beans Game (which is a bean grabbing game with chopsticks, Juichu (which is a going under a rope game), and Othella (the turning over race), come play and enjoy the outdoors!!! Felting Class
Meeting Room A 131 N. Walnut St., Batesville, IN, United StatesFelting is one of the oldest forms of textile arts. Needle felting is begun by rolling a small amount of wool and stabbing it with the needle. It is a quick hobby to learn, and many find it stress-relieving. Join us this month as we learn how to "paint with wool" a flower photo! All material will be supplied. We will meet inside the library.
